The Proper Way to Play Video Poker

Video Poker is a favored game that is able to be gambled on in casinos all over the globe, or in your house on your personal computer, using a web account. The game rules are absolutely simple and involve the player trying to achieve the highest mixture of cards possible in order to win money. On this account it’s much the same as a normal game of poker, without the involvement with other players. Of course, techniques used in a real-life game of poker, like tricking, will be irrelevant in Video Poker.

The game of Electronic Poker begins when the bettor puts credits (either tokens, tickets or money) into the video poker machine and presses the draw button. A hand of five cards will then be "handed out" on the screen.

The Video Poker game also has buttons with ‘hold’ printed on them, and players will need to now pick which cards to hold and which to throw away. For the cards the enthusiast wishes to keep, the ‘hold’ buttons need to be pressed so that they light up. The player can choose to keep any amount of cards they wish, from all to none.

After the player has decided on which cards he wishes to retain, the player will then press ‘draw’, which will mean that any new cards are dealt if desired. The round is now completed, with the Video Poker machine analyzing the hand to see if it is the same as any of the winning hands shown on the payout schedule.

Normally, the lowest winning hand on an Electronic Poker machine is a pair of jacks with the prize money increasing for each and every better hand. A list of common winning hands starts with jacks or better, and moves on to 2 pairs, three of a kinds, straights, flushes, full houses, four of a kinds, straight flushes and finally royal flushes. It is obvious that the payment schedule can range from game to game, so that experienced players are able to pick the most profitable ones every time.

As soon as the first round has played out, the player can either decide to continue on and try to to maximize their winnings, or press the ‘collect’ button to cash out any money that has been won. Additionally, several styles of the game give the enthusiast an opportunity to increase their winnings, in which situation a further round is played. There are also differences between specific machines, with some virtual decks including wild cards and other differing characteristics to enhance playability.
